Before Moving Off

Whenever you plan to use your motorhome it is
good practice to run through this simple check
list before you set off:
• Ensure that there is sufficient gas to meet
your needs.
• Check that gas cylinders are securely
fastened.
• Turn off the gas supply, and all gas appliances
- only leave gas on if your motorhome has a
Truma MonoControl CS safety gas pressure
regulator.
• Turn OFF all gas manifold taps (located
under the sink).
• Ensure that the gas cylinder and locker door
are securely fastened.
• Switch off the 230V supply at the site's hook-
up supply pillar; disconnect the mains cable
from the vehicle.

• Check both the control panel and the PDU
box for operation.
• Check and, if necessary, charge your leisure
battery. This can be viewed on your control
panel.
• Check that the battery is secure and that the
battery box door is securely fastened.
• Ensure that the fridge is set to 12V operation
and the door lock is set. (Please note that
the electrical relays will allow the fridge to
run on the vehicle battery when the engine
is running.)
• Ensure, if required, that your fresh water tank
is full and your waste water tank is empty.
• Remove
connections, coil and store in a secure place.
• Ensure that the toilet flush tank only contains
a small amount of water (1–2 litres) in order
to minimise the risk of leaks or spillage while
the vehicle is in motion.
• Move the toilet blade handle to the closed
position; refer to 'Using The Toilet' on page
141.
• Close and secure all cupboards and drawers
and check for any loose articles.

• Do not store tins, jars, cylinders, etc in
overhead lockers.
• Close and secure all windows and roof lights.
• Leave all curtains and blinds open.
• Make sure any heavy articles are stored in
accordance with the loading procedure.
• Ensure tables are in their specified storage
compartments.
• Lock the habitation door (remember to
remove the keys).
• Check your wing mirrors and adjust if
necessary.
• Check that the wheel bolts are secure and
that the tyre pressures are correct.
• Check underneath the vehicle for any stray
items.
• Safely store your levelling blocks away in an
appropriate place.
